Average Shuttle Drivers and Chauffeurs Salary in Santa Rosa-Petaluma, CA

In Santa Rosa-Petaluma, CA, Shuttle Drivers and Chauffeurs earn an average annual salary of $45,130, significantly exceeding the national average of $38,900. This higher compensation is likely driven by the region's specific economic demands and potentially a higher cost of doing business, making specialized driving roles more valuable.

Executive Summary

  • Average Salary: $45,130 per year.
  • Growth Trend: Salaries have shifted 0.0% over the last 5 years.
  • Top Earners: Senior professionals (90th percentile) earn up to $57,470.
  • Outlook: The local market for Shuttle Drivers and Chauffeurs in Santa Rosa-Petaluma, CA, shows a healthy concentration with a Location Quotient of 1.2, indicating a presence slightly above the national average. With a total local workforce of 370 in this role, the demand appears stable and well-integrated into the regional economy, suggesting a robust job market for these professionals.

Methodology: Salary data is derived from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) OEWS 2024 release. Figures represent gross pay before taxes. Analysis includes 370 employees in the Santa Rosa-Petaluma, CA area with a job density of 1.791 per 1,000 jobs. Cost of Living data is estimated based on state and metro averages.
